The recommended anti-corrosion additive was to buffer the pH of the non-lead bearing water from the river, to prevent leaching of lead from the old pipes. The ‘swill’ was brewed within the piping of the Flint water district, based on a ‘local’ decision not to follow the engineering recommendation.

Do you believe the governors office follows the minutia of city council decisions statewide, and is responsible for poor local choices? The people at the local level implemented the changes, and neglected consequences of their obviously short-sighted decision.

Flints problem is not that their infrastructure failed it’s that they pumped water that had to have so much chlorine to be treated to safe levels that it had trihalomethane in it, which is corrosive and that is what leached the lead from the pipes. All they had to do was add phosphate to the treated water to stop this but didn’t and that is what caused this... It is not the lead pipes that are the problem.

Most North Eastern cities have many lead pipes in their water system. The fact is that most homes built before 1970 have lead solder in their pipes. It is the water. The water had been treated in order to prevent lead from leaching into it.

The city decided to save money and disconnect from Detroit and connect to the local water supply.
